Transaction

fe86983ea6d64fb2aefefc055341a0db8865f1ca0a343a7e98ae0f0d1d25a5cf
517,113 confirmations
Timestamp
1468610588
Block420,863
Fee6,685 sats
Fee rate35.2 sats/vB
view on mempool.space

Inputs & Outputs